Output 89537c58616c56a96fd9843297bbe5e38114f90b5c6391608f08d146d0f1bf9b:0

value
26900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ccaa9e622d1c4fc12a19b10de8d9dcb2783a37d6 OP_EQUAL
address
3LMCAUHa8K1y8sybEETdXQxSV5aRT5AERc
transaction
89537c58616c56a96fd9843297bbe5e38114f90b5c6391608f08d146d0f1bf9b
spent
true